1. Traditional Self-Storage Facilities

Traditional self-storage companies operate large, professionally managed warehouses or storage buildings that rent out individual units to customers. These units come in various sizes from locker-style compartments for documents and valuables to full room spaces that can fit furniture or business inventory.

Features:

  • 24/7 Security Monitoring (CCTV, guards, access logs)
  • Climate-Controlled Units (for electronics, art, or perishables)
  • Pest-Control Measures
  • Packing and Pickup Services
  • Fixed Rental Periods (weekly, monthly or annual contracts)
Popular in Bengaluru:
  • SafeStorage – Household and business storage; insurance and transportation support.
  • StowNest – Professional handling and flexible rentals; good for household items.
  • Space Valet – High-end storage with climate-controlled facilities; valuable items.
  • EzySpaces – QR-coded item tagging and digital inventory tracking.

Cost:

Bengaluru storage costs typically range from ₹250 to ₹500 per month for basic box or locker storage. Larger units can cost ₹1,000 or more per month depending on location and services.

Limitations:

    • Located on the outskirts or in industrial areas which can be inconvenient.
    • Access may require notice or appointments.
  • Minimum rental duration (e.g., 3 months or more).
  • Extra charges for pickup, insurance or climate control.

Tips for Choosing the Right Storage Option in Bengaluru

Comparing costs is only one aspect of selecting the best storage option in Bengaluru.. It’s about understanding your needs how much you want to store, how often you need access, how long you’ll need the space, and how secure it needs to be. Whether you’re leaning toward a traditional warehouse facility or exploring peer-to-peer platforms like PeerVault, the tips below will help you make a well-informed decision.

1. Define Your Storage Volume

Your first step is to understand how much space you actually need.

  • Small items (books, clothes, kitchenware)?
    A cardboard box-sized plan from providers like HomeTriangle or Moving Solutions may be enough. These services offer low-cost storage with per-box pricing and are ideal for students or individuals between leases.
  • Larger items like appliances or furniture?
    Go for room-sized units in traditional warehouses or opt for a P2P host with available home or garage space via PeerVault. P2P platforms give you more size flexibility, especially when your needs don’t fit into conventional unit categories.
  • Business inventory, files, or documents?
    Choose Ezyspaces or Infinite Storage, which offer office-style storage with digital tracking and humidity control—ideal for maintaining sensitive materials.

4. Don’t Forget Transport & Pickup Costs

Moving your stuff to a storage facility is often an overlooked expense.

  • Traditional warehouse services may offer:
    • Doorstep pickup, usually at a cost
    • Packing and unpacking services
    • Scheduled vehicle slots, especially for large items
  • P2P platforms like PeerVault:
    • Leave transport to you or let you coordinate directly with the host
    • This can reduce costs and give you more control over how and when your items are moved
    • Great if you’re moving with help from friends or ride-hailing apps
